Brief Title: A Study of YZJ-4729 Tartrate Injection for the Treatment of Pain After Abdominal Surgery

Official Title: A Phase Ⅲ,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o- and Active-controlled Study of YZJ-4729 Tartrate Injection for the Treatment of Moderate to Severe Pain After Abdominal Surgery

Brief Summary: The primary objective is to evaluate the analgesic efficacy and safety of IV YZJ-4729 Tartrate Injection in patients with acute postoperative pain following abdominal surgery.
